Aquatica True Ofuro Mini Japanese Soaking Bathtub has been inspired by the ancient Japanese traditions of soaking in Ofuro tubs. After the launch of our True Ofuro, we created a smaller and taller version of this sit and soak, solid surface bathtub, naming it the True Ofuro Mini. This soaking tub features a deeper design for a cosy, full-body immersion. Designed in EU, this is an immaculately sculpted model. The True Ofuro Mini is taller and deeper and features a slightly elevated rim for improved neck and head support, as well as a convenient ergonomic built in seat, allowing the body to be comfortably emerged to maximum water capacity. The height of the True Ofuro Mini is substantially taller than the original True Ofuro and therefore we recommend people who are shorter than 170cm also purchase our Stylish wooden step.Aquatica international industrial design team, used advanced CAD tools, modelling and repeated testing with real size prototype units, so that we could reach the optimal balance between ergonomic comfort and visual appeal.Our AquateX material is the star in this Japanese soaking tub as it retains heat much longer and also has a silky and velvety surface. This bathtub is currently one of our most space conscious bathtubs at a size of 43" x 43" (1090x1090mm), making the freestanding and petite construction of this Japanese bathtub easy to be installed in any sized bathroom.

What is the Best Bathtub Material?
Choosing the right material for your bathtub is crucial for both the aesthetic and functionality of your bathroom. Hereʼs a brief guide:- Durability: Cast iron and acrylic are renowned for their long-lasting qualities.
- Heat Retention: Cast iron and copper keep water warm for longer periods, enhancing your bathing experience.
- Ease of Maintenance: Acrylic and fiberglass are easy to clean and maintain, making them practical choices.
- Aesthetic Appeal: Stone and copper bathtubs add a luxurious touch to any bathroom.
How Wide Should a Bathtub Be? What are the Standard widths?
The width of your bathtub can significantly impact your comfort and the overall spatial dynamics of your bathroom. Standard bathtubs typically range from 29 to 32 inches in width. For those desiring extra space or aiming for a soaking or whirlpool experience, wider tubs of up to 36 inches or more might be preferable. The capacity of a bathtub can greatly influence your bathing experience, affecting everything from the depth of your soak to the amount of water used. On average, a standard bathtub holds between 25 to 45 gallons of water, while larger models like soaking or whirlpool tubs can accommodate up to 80 gallons or more. For the most accurate measurement, always refer to the product details of the specific tub youʼre interested in.
